rsk360 Posted January 24, 2009 Share Posted January 24, 2009 o my bad. i knew he had lefted...i never knew he returned On August 24, 2007 Matusiak signed a three-year contact with an option for a fourth with Dutch side SC Heerenveen. In January 2008, however, he returned to Poland, being loaned for the duration of the season to Wisła Kraków. In the summer of 2008 his contract with Heerenveen was canceled by mutual agreement. He spent the first half of the 2008-09 season pursuing interests outside of football but rejected media reports that he had retired from the sport. On December 23, 2008 he signed with Widzew Łódź. thats of wiki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...
